Bocca della Verità: Reality and Myths
Sponsored links
The Bocca della Verità is a large marble disc, that, in spite of the myths surrounding it, was probably a grave cover in the form of a mask representing a faun dating back to the Ist century. It is placed inside the church of Santa Maria in Cosmedin. A visit to this famous ''mascherone'' is a compulsory stop for every tourist in Rome. Before visiting it will be important to note some of the historical features of the Bocca della Verità, as well as have a description of the famous “mascherone of lies”, and the directions to get there.
For centuries the Bocca della Verità has been a regular stop for Roman tours due to its peculiarity and its charm. Several directors have also been attracted by the myth of this monument and have included it in their films. The most famous is certainly “Roman Holiday” but also the Italian film “La Bocca della Verità”, and the Japanese film “Sleeping Bride”.
Bocca della Verità: Historical Features
The Bocca della Verità was used to unmask lies in the Middle Ages and to judge a defendant’s innocence or guilt. If after putting his (or her) hand in the disc, he (or she) managed to extract it, they were considered innocent. In case of guilt, the defendant ran the risk of having his hand cut off. It is also said that the judges, if certain of the person’s guilt, would order to cut the hand by a third person, hidden behind the mask.
Bocca della Verità: Description
The Bocca della Verità is placed in the portico of the church of Santa Maria in Cosmedin, erected in the VI century. It is composed of a big marble disc, 1.80 meters in diameter, about 1,300 kg in weight, attached to the wall in the church’s portico in 1632. The face represented by on the disc has been attributed to different subjects, among them Jupiter Ammon, the god Ocean, an oracle, or the most probable, a faun.
Bocca della Verità: How to Get There
The entrance to Bocca della Verità is in piazza Bocca della Verità. Public transportation, the bus lines numbers 95, 160, 170, 44, 716 and 781 arrive at the Bocca della Verità stop. The nearest underground stop is Circo Massimo (Rome Metro B Line), only 300 meters away from where you will be able to put your hand in the famous mask.
